John Bender, the New York-based CEO of global reinsurance solutions provider Allied World Re, threw out the ceremonial first pitch at the Boston Red Sox vs. New York Yankees game on August 10.
Bender is the founder and chairman emeritus for The St. Baldrick’s Foundation, a Monrovia, Calif., based charity dedicated to raising money for children’s cancer research. He accepted the invitation to throw the game’s first pitch in order to raise awareness for the foundation and its need for childhood cancer research funding.
